Overview of the Project
Deira Island is a significant construction undertaking by Nakheel, the real estate developer behind some of Dubai's most iconic landmarks. Designed to stretch over 15 square kilometers, it aims to redefine waterfront living in the city. The project will comprise a mix of hotels, retail outlets, and residential units, aiming to offer a comprehensive experience to residents and visitors alike.
Key features include:
- Four major islands, each catering to distinct populations and experiences.
- A series of leisure, retail, and dining options in alignment with Dubai's robust tourism sector.
- A central feature, the Deira Night Souk, which will encapsulate local culture and provide a vibrant marketplace for residents and tourists.
The ambitious goals of the project pinpoint it as a new focal point for Dubai’s evolving architecture, aiming to draw in both international visitors and local investors.

Comparisons with Palm Jumeirah
Palm Jumeirah, a model of luxury and innovation, has set a high benchmark in Dubai's real estate market. Its success story is interwoven with its distinctive design and premium offerings that cater to affluent buyers and tourists alike. Key comparison points for Deira Island include:
- Design and Layout: While Palm Jumeirah resembles a palm tree seen from above, Deira Island's design aims for an integrated urban environment where residential, commercial, and recreational spaces coexist harmoniously.
- Market Positioning: Palm Jumeirah caters primarily to luxury markets, positioning itself as a premier destination for high-end living and tourism. Conversely, Deira Island plans to attract a broader demographic, focusing on affordability without compromising quality, which could make it more accessible for diverse groups.
- Tourist Attractions: Palm Jumeirah boasts landmark resorts and attractions like Atlantis. Deira Island envisions a mix of entertainment options, spanning from cultural experiences to modern shopping avenues, which may appeal to both tourists and locals.
- Economic Contributions: The economic ripple effect of Palm Jumeirah is evident in tourism, luxury spending, and job creation. Deira Island is expected to generate similar benefits, but focusing on sustainability and the local economy's strengthening, paving the way for a different kind of growth.
